Les Tourist Trap? Fatigue clouded our judgment when we picked a random restaurant close to our hotel for dinner. The jazz group was just setting up and the music drew us in. It was pleasant, but nothing special. It turned out to be the highlight of our experience.
The seats were uncomfortable and the service was perfunctory and slow. We ordered steaks and they were obviously of poor quality. The texture was unpleasant and it was slightly overcooked from my request for medium rare. The bearnaise was gloppy and almost flavorless. I scraped it off. The potato was gluey.
The prices are a bit steep, but I have to admit that I was so tired that I didn't even bother to complain. The lack of pride, service, and culinary skill made me think that it wouldn't be worth it. [05 Apr 2007 18:10:45]
